NAME
gcloud beta runtime-config configs variables get-value - output values of
variable resources
SYNOPSIS
gcloud beta runtime-config configs variables get-value NAME
--config-name=CONFIG_NAME [GCLOUD_WIDE_FLAG ...]
DESCRIPTION
(BETA) This command prints only the value of the variable resource with the
specified name, and does not append a trailing newline character. It can be
used as part of shell expansions.
EXAMPLES
To print the value of a variable named "my-var", run:
$ gcloud beta runtime-config configs variables get-value \
--config-name=my-config my-var
Values will be automatically base64-decoded.
POSITIONAL ARGUMENTS
NAME
The variable name.
REQUIRED FLAGS
--config-name=CONFIG_NAME
The name of the configuration resource to use.
GCLOUD WIDE FLAGS
These flags are available to all commands: --access-token-file, --account,
--billing-project, --configuration, --flags-file, --flatten, --format,
--help, --impersonate-service-account, --log-http, --project, --quiet,
--trace-token, --user-output-enabled, --verbosity.
Run $ gcloud help for details.
NOTES
This command is currently in beta and might change without notice.
